The Nene the other day apparently wasn't on Strong stream at any point properly.

Contractors had left a coffer dam in place following wier work and as soon as the rain came, it triggered flood sensors at one lock, hence the on off on off messages.

The Nene has plenty of room left for water, weed is clearing nicely and shouldn't go into flood at all this week although there will be a good flow and may go into strong stream for real.
